On 28 January 2026, second-year students from the Department of Plant Science, Faculty of Science, Mahidol University were given the opportunity to participate in an academic study visit as part of the course Selected Topics in Plant Science at the National Biobank Thailand, under the National Science and Technology Development Agency (NSTDA).
The study visit was supervised by Associate Professor Dr. Saroj Ruchisansakun, the course instructor. The objective of this activity was to enhance students’ knowledge and understanding of biobank systems, particularly in the areas of biological resource collection, preservation, and management, which play a crucial role in supporting research and development in plant science, biology, and biotechnology.
During the visit, students attended a special lecture delivered by experts from the National Biobank Thailand and explored the operational processes of the biobank, including sample acquisition, storage systems, quality control, and the utilization of biological resources for scientific research and sustainable innovation.
This educational activity provided valuable hands-on experience and broadened students’ perspectives in plant science and related fields. It also served as an important opportunity to inspire students and strengthen their academic foundation for future research and professional development, contributing to the advancement of scientific personnel in Thailand.
